Reimbursement for War Risk Insurance Costs

According to Мін. Економіки: A total of 6.8 million hryvnias has been paid out to four Ukrainian enterprises to cover the cost of insuring their property against war-related hazards. The average insurance rate has dropped from 4.24% to 1.19% as a result of this initiative. Operating since January 2026, the program is part of the broader 'Made in Ukraine' policy framework designed to bolster domestic business resilience.

These reimbursements were distributed through the private joint-stock company Export Credit Agency (ECA). Minister Oleksiy Sobolev commented:

“War risks remain one of the biggest hurdles for businesses in Ukraine. The state is stepping in to help companies reduce the expense of insuring their property against this threat.”

Compensation Program Details

The program offers two main forms of support:

  • Direct compensation for losses sustained by enterprises located in frontline regions;
  • Partial reimbursement of insurance premiums for businesses operating anywhere across Ukraine.

This initiative marks a significant step in backing Ukrainian businesses, especially given that war risks severely complicate commercial operations. By lowering the cost of insurance, it aims to enhance financial stability for companies, which in turn supports the country’s economic development during wartime.

As the government continues to support local businesses amidst ongoing challenges, it is crucial for enterprises to be aware of the measures available to document their losses effectively. Starting April 29, companies will have the opportunity to officially record damages incurred due to the conflict with Russia, which can play a vital role in securing necessary compensations.
